Telescopes are used to see things that are far away from earth. Using telescopes we can see things that are millions of miles away. Most of the telescopes are on Earth but some of them are in space such as the Hubble Space Telescope.

What is the equipment used in astronomy?

Some common equipment used in astronomy includes telescopes, cameras, spectrometers, and computers. Telescopes are used to observe celestial objects, while cameras capture images for analysis. Spectrometers are used to analyze the light from stars and galaxies, and computers are used for data processing and analysis.

What Are Radeo Telescopes?

Do you mean Radio Telescopes? A radio telescope is a form of directional radio antenna used in radio astronomy. The same types of antennas are also used in tracking and collecting data from satellites and space probes.

Are telescopes and microscopes used by astronomers?

Telescopes are commonly used by astronomers to observe objects in space such as planets, stars, and galaxies. Microscopes are not typically used by astronomers as they are designed for studying very small objects on Earth, such as cells and microbes.


What were telescopes first used for?

Telescopes were first used for astronomical observations in the early 17th century, primarily to study celestial objects such as the Moon, planets, and stars. The first recorded use of a telescope for astronomy was by Galileo Galilei in 1609, who made significant discoveries including the moons of Jupiter and the phases of Venus. These advancements challenged existing views of the cosmos and laid the groundwork for modern astronomy. Ultimately, telescopes expanded our understanding of the universe and our place within it.


What is the name of a place that uses telescopes and other scientific equipment to space and astronomy?

An observatory is the name of a place that uses telescopes and other scientific equipment to study space and astronomy. The Mount Polamar Observitory in the west of the US is an iconic example. Today, Earth based observitories are supplimented by space telescopes.
